With most online videos, totem will do progressive download, filling up its buffer and then starting playback while it continues to download the rest of the video. For some reason it won't do this with FLV files. It doesn't start playing until the entire video is downloaded. I first noticed this on YouTube using a greasemonkey script that replaces the flash player with a native plugin. fmt=18 videos, which are mp4, begin playing almost immediately, while fmt=34 or fmt=35, which are flv, do not. I then confirmed it with some other videos.
